Basic Components of a Pipes System


Pipelines and Tubes


At the heart of your plumbing system are the pipelines and tubing that carry water throughout your home. These can be made from various materials such as copper, PVC, or PEX, each with its advantages in terms of resilience and cost-effectiveness.

Components: Sinks, Toilets, Showers, etc.


Fixtures like sinks, bathrooms, showers, and bath tubs are where water is used in your home. Comprehending exactly how these fixtures connect to the pipes system helps in detecting problems and preparing upgrades.

Shutoffs and Shut-off Points


Shutoffs control the circulation of water in your plumbing system. Shut-off valves are important throughout emergencies or when you need to make repair work, enabling you to isolate parts of the system without disrupting water circulation to the whole house.

Supply Of Water System


Main Water Line


The primary water line links your home to the community water system or a personal well. It's where water enters your home and is distributed to various components.

Water Meter and Pressure Regulator


The water meter measures your water use, while a stress regulatory authority guarantees that water flows at a safe pressure throughout your home's plumbing system, protecting against damages to pipes and fixtures.

Cold Water vs. Warm water Lines


Recognizing the difference between cold water lines, which supply water directly from the major, and hot water lines, which lug heated water from the hot water heater, aids in troubleshooting and planning for upgrades.

Drain System


Drain Piping and Traps


Drain pipes carry wastewater away from sinks, showers, and commodes to the sewer or sewage-disposal tank. Catches prevent drain gases from entering your home and likewise catch debris that might create clogs.

Air flow Pipelines


Air flow pipelines enable air right into the drainage system, avoiding suction that could reduce water drainage and trigger catches to vacant. Correct ventilation is important for keeping the honesty of your pipes system.

Significance of Appropriate Water Drainage


Making sure appropriate drainage prevents backups and water damages. Frequently cleansing drains pipes and keeping catches can stop pricey repair services and expand the life of your pipes system.

Water Heating Unit


Sorts Of Water Heaters


Hot water heater can be tankless or typical tank-style. Tankless heating units warm water as needed, while storage tanks keep warmed water for prompt use.

Exactly How Water Heaters Link to the Pipes System


Recognizing just how water heaters link to both the cold water supply and warm water distribution lines assists in identifying issues like insufficient hot water or leakages.

Upkeep Tips for Water Heaters


Frequently flushing your water heater to get rid of debris, examining the temperature settings, and examining for leaks can extend its life-span and enhance energy efficiency.

Usual Pipes Concerns


Leakages and Their Reasons


Leakages can occur due to maturing pipelines, loose installations, or high water stress. Resolving leakages immediately avoids water damage and mold and mildew growth.

Obstructions and Blockages


Clogs in drains and commodes are frequently triggered by flushing non-flushable things or a buildup of oil and hair. Using drainpipe displays and being mindful of what goes down your drains can prevent obstructions.

Indications of Pipes Problems to Look For


Low water stress, sluggish drains, foul odors, or abnormally high water costs are indications of prospective plumbing problems that ought to be attended to without delay.

Main Building Codes


The plumbing system layout for a home must adhere to all applicable local construction requirements. The number of fixtures permitted on a given drain system, vent stack, the location of supply drains, and lines are all specified by the relevant building regulations.


It is important to have a well-designed plumbing system that complies with all applicable regulations. It is built with meticulous attention to detail so that it may pass muster during building inspections and adhere to all applicable rules and regulations.


Draft Of Supply


These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.


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.


Gas Piping


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.


Heightening of the DWV


The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. A reference drawing doesn't have to be made directly on top of architectural plans.


Pipes of the Appropriate Dimensions


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.


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.


The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
